Description
Living Room - Power points, radiator, front aspect upvc double glazed bay window, stairs leading to first floor, door leading to:
Kitchen Diner - Range of base, wall and drawer mounted units, sink unit with mixer tap over, appliance points, power points, four ring gas hob with extractor hood over, integrated dishwasher, oven and microwave, space for washing machine, radiator, rear aspect upvc double glazed window, french doors leading to rear garden.
Bedroom One - TV points, power points, radiator, two storage cupboards, front aspect upvc double glazed window, door leading to:
En Suite - Suite comprising of, walk in shower with shower off the mains over, low level wc, wash hand basin with storage below, heated towel rail, side aspect upvc frosted double glazed window, partly tiled walls.
Bedroom Two - Power points, radiator, rear aspect upvc double glazed window.
Bathroom - Suite comprising of, panelled bath with shower off the mains over, low level wc, pedestal wash hand basin, heated towel rail, partly tiled walls, rear aspect upvc frosted double glazed window.
Outside - To the front of the property there is a driveway for two off road vehicles with side by side parking,
To the rear of the property is a low maintenance enclosed garden, the garden is laid with patio and bordered with decorative slate and shrubs, an ideal garden for outdoor seating and entertainment.
